## Formula sandbox tuning

User-supplied formulas in Gridmoor execute inside a restricted interpreter with hard ceilings on time, memory, and call depth. Reviewers should confirm any change to these ceilings is justified in the PR description, since raising them widens the abuse surface. Defaults were chosen from production traces. The current limits are as follows.

limits module of tafog-fawip:
WEIGHTS = {
    "julix": 57,
    "lamys": 992,
    "kasvan": 209,
    "quenok": 750,
    "alddor": 259,
    "oliath": 1009,
    "wenix": 815,
}

Handover note — Crumbwheel order cutoffs.

Welcome aboard. The bakery cutoff rule in Crumbwheel closes same-day orders at 14:00 local to each storefront, not UTC — this has bitten us twice. Holiday overrides live in the calendar service and take precedence silently, so always check there first when a cutoff looks wrong. To unlock the calendar service's admin console after a restart, enter the recovery passphrase below.

vault phrase of bagap-bahaf = silion-pelox-sorox-casdor-quenwyn-fraax-eliox-praael-kelion-quenvan-kasox-rusael-norius-belvan

Heads of department: Q3 review complete. Expanding the Arlenford plant adds 18% throughput at a payback of 3.1 years; outsourcing to Brackley Tooling is cheaper year one but erodes margin by year three. Utilisation at Arlenford has held above 92% for five straight months. Maintenance backlog is funded. Recommendation: approve phased expansion, capex split over two years, contingent on demand holding through Q1. Decision required at Thursday's session. The confidential note below covers the plans informing this recommendation.

board note of tawig-bajof: The renewal with Ralixix Holdings closes at $10 million a year, 20 percent above the last contract. Project Druix slips by two quarters because of the tooling delay.

### Step 4: Trace Store Cutover

Tracing spans from the Lorvik mesh now write to the consolidated trace database instead of per-service files. Verify span IDs propagate across the payments and ledger services before sign-off. Access is read-only for review purposes. Connect to the trace store using the connection string provided below.

primary connection of yagep-kahip = redis://giliel_svc:zYiKsLL2PLpfPL@db-348f.xolmarsys.corp:5432/fenwyn